Output 2382680b33af5d4b667208beeccf300a9bdc9cacdf2b43d010f75b069cf37d54:30

value
10739094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1a8c21b6690847b885fd518b88083a44a25df4c OP_EQUAL
address
3KLzW6RyqUssYuriXUUEvGLepBQsU8mBb1
transaction
2382680b33af5d4b667208beeccf300a9bdc9cacdf2b43d010f75b069cf37d54
spent
true